Kimberly-Clark de Mexico SAB de CV Earnings Call Summary

Earnings Call Date:Jan 22, 2026
(Q4-2025)
|
% Change Since: |
Next Earnings Date:Apr 21, 2026
Earnings Call Sentiment Positive
The call presented a largely positive quarter and constructive outlook: Q4 showed revenue growth, significant margin and EBITDA improvement, strong cost-savings execution, healthy cash generation and a strong balance sheet. Management acknowledged ongoing headwinds—soft consumer demand, competitive intensity, a 10% contraction in Away-from-Home and full-year margin pressure—while outlining clear mitigation plans (continued cost reductions, pricing/mix initiatives, innovation, private label participation and potential strategic opportunities from Kenvue integration). Given the weight of tangible operational and financial improvements and an optimistic but cautious outlook, the tone is constructive and forward-looking.
Positive Updates
Fourth Quarter Revenue Growth
Sales reached MXN 14.1 billion in Q4, up 2.1% year-over-year, with sequential sales growth of 4.8% versus Q3.

Company Guidance
Guidance from the call pointed to stronger momentum in 2026 versus 2025, driven by expected tailwinds from lower pulp, recycled fibers, resins and superabsorbent materials plus a supportive peso (Q4 average appreciation ~8%), with the company already identifying upwards of MXN 1.0 billion of cost savings for 2026 (on top of MXN 1.95 billion delivered in 2025 and ~MXN 500 million in Q4), plans to continue pricing and mix actions, and an ambition to keep cost reduction as a structural lever that could deliver savings close to 2025 levels; management expects Away‑from‑Home to recover by Q2, pet food to be a breakout category in 2026, will evaluate potential integration of Kenvue Mexico (roughly $200 million in sales), and will propose a high‑single‑digit dividend increase and a significant share repurchase program at the Feb. 26 shareholders’ meeting, while operating with a healthy balance sheet (cash MXN 9.7 billion, net debt/EBITDA ~1.0x, EBITDA/interest ~10x).

Kimberly-Clark de Mexico SAB de CV Financial Statement Overview

Summary
Income statement strength (high gross margin ~41% and solid net margin) and consistently positive free cash flow support a good operating profile, but recent revenue decline and weaker 2025 operating/FCF trends reduce momentum. Balance-sheet leverage remains a meaningful risk despite evident deleveraging.
